#ifndef HGL_GRAPH_MATERIAL_COMPONENT_INCLUDE
#define HGL_GRAPH_MATERIAL_COMPONENT_INCLUDE
#include<hgl/type/DataType.h>
#define MATERIAL_NAMESPACE_BEGIN namespace hgl{namespace graph{namespace material{
#define MATERIAL_NAMESPACE_END }}}
#define MATERIAL_NAMESPACE hgl::graph::material
#define MATERIAL_NAMESPACE_USING using namespace MATERIAL_NAMESPACE;
MATERIAL_NAMESPACE_BEGIN
enum class Component
{
ShadingModel=0,
BaseColor,
Mask,
Opacity,
Normal,
Metallic,
Roughness,
Emissive,
Refraction,
AO,
SSS,
Height,
RIM,
ClearCoat,
Anisotropy,
BEGIN_RANGE =ShadingModel,
END_RANGE =Anisotropy,
RANGE_SIZE =END_RANGE-BEGIN_RANGE+1,
};//enum class Component
enum class ComponentBit
{
#define MC_BIT_DEFINE(name) name=1<<(uint)Component::name
MC_BIT_DEFINE(ShadingModel ),
MC_BIT_DEFINE(BaseColor ),
MC_BIT_DEFINE(Mask ),
MC_BIT_DEFINE(Opacity ),
MC_BIT_DEFINE(Normal ),
MC_BIT_DEFINE(Metallic ),
MC_BIT_DEFINE(Roughness ),
MC_BIT_DEFINE(Emissive ),
MC_BIT_DEFINE(Refraction ),
MC_BIT_DEFINE(AO ),
MC_BIT_DEFINE(SSS ),
MC_BIT_DEFINE(Height ),
MC_BIT_DEFINE(RIM ),
MC_BIT_DEFINE(ClearCoat ),
MC_BIT_DEFINE(Anisotropy ),
#undef MC_BIT_DEFINE
};//enum class ComponentBit
enum class ComponentDataType
{
Bool=0,
Float,
Double,
Int,
Uint,
};//enum class ComponentDataType
enum class DataFormat
{
NONE=0,
#define MATERIAL_DATA_FORMAT_DEFINE(short_name,type) type =((uint(ComponentDataType::type)<<4)|1), \
Vector##2##short_name =((uint(ComponentDataType::type)<<4)|2), \
Vector##3##short_name =((uint(ComponentDataType::type)<<4)|3), \
Vector##4##short_name =((uint(ComponentDataType::type)<<4)|4)
MATERIAL_DATA_FORMAT_DEFINE(b,Bool ),
MATERIAL_DATA_FORMAT_DEFINE(f,Float ),
MATERIAL_DATA_FORMAT_DEFINE(d,Double),
MATERIAL_DATA_FORMAT_DEFINE(i,Int ),
MATERIAL_DATA_FORMAT_DEFINE(u,Uint ),
#undef MATERIAL_DATA_FORMAT_DEFINE
};//enum class DataFormat
inline const ComponentDataType GetFormatBaseType (const DataFormat &df){return ComponentDataType(uint(df)>>4);}
inline const uint GetFormatChannels (const DataFormat &df){return uint(df)&7;}
using ComponentBitsConfig=uint32;
constexpr ComponentBitsConfig MCC_PureColor =uint32(ComponentBit::BaseColor);
constexpr ComponentBitsConfig MCC_PureNormal =uint32(ComponentBit::Normal);
constexpr ComponentBitsConfig MCC_PureOpacity =uint32(ComponentBit::Opacity);
constexpr ComponentBitsConfig MCC_ColorNormal =uint32(ComponentBit::BaseColor)|uint32(ComponentBit::Normal);
constexpr ComponentBitsConfig MCC_CNMR =uint32(ComponentBit::BaseColor)|uint32(ComponentBit::Normal)|uint32(ComponentBit::Metallic)|uint32(ComponentBit::Roughness);
struct ComponentConfig
{
Component comp; ///<成份ID
ComponentDataType type; ///<数据类型
uint channels; ///<通道数
bool LinearColorspace; ///<是要求线性颜色空间
};//struct ComponentConfig
const ComponentConfig *GetConfig(const Component c);
MATERIAL_NAMESPACE_END
#endif//HGL_GRAPH_MATERIAL_COMPONENT_INCLUDE
